RATIONALE
Economics is vital to a changing modern life as it seeks to understand, assess and explain the mechanisms of markets and national economies. This importance of Economics to the Botswana Economy is as espoused in the National Development Plan (NDP 11) and the Vision 2036. Botswana, through Vision 2036, aims at achieving the pillars of Sustainable Economic Development and Human and Social Development. The two pillars emphasize transformation to a knowledge based economy that would enable citizens to globally compete in driving economic growth and diversification. There is need to therefore develop skills, competencies and experts who will drive this transformation.

ENTRY REQUIREMENTS
- Degree, Post Graduate Diploma in Economics or any equivalent qualification in the fields of Business, Commerce and Management Studies with compulsory modules in Microeconomics, Macroeconomics and Mathematics/Statistics.
- Candidates who do not have these minimum academic qualifications but have five years relevant work experience in a related field, will be considered.
